19: Idealogical Purity Ideas (with Brianna Wu)
Manage episode 194159286 series 1853309
Brianna is running for Congress! She stops by to share her insights about the work of running a campaign, seeking to support people you don't agree with, and why Millennials need to take direct action instead of making symbolic political gestures. We also get into info security, online harassment, and then some inside-baseball talk about Apple and the future of gaming.
